学编程入门教程用什么软件
-
学编程入门教程可以使用多种软件,具体选择取决于你想学习的编程语言和个人喜好。下面我会介绍几款常用的编程软件,供你参考。
-
Python语言:对于Python语言的学习,可以使用Anaconda或者Python官方提供的IDLE软件。Anaconda是一个集成了Python和众多常用科学计算库的软件包,可以方便地进行Python开发和数据分析。而Python IDLE是Python官方提供的一个简单的集成开发环境,适合初学者使用。
-
Java语言:Java语言的学习可以使用Eclipse或者IntelliJ IDEA等集成开发环境。Eclipse是一个功能强大且广泛使用的Java开发工具,具有丰富的插件和调试功能。IntelliJ IDEA是一个针对Java开发的IDE,提供了智能代码提示和强大的代码分析功能。
-
C/C++语言:对于C/C++语言的学习,可以使用Code::Blocks或者Visual Studio等开发工具。Code::Blocks是一个开源的集成开发环境,适合学习和开发C/C++程序。Visual Studio是微软推出的一款强大的IDE,支持多种编程语言,包括C/C++。
-
Web开发:对于Web开发,你可以使用Sublime Text、Visual Studio Code或者Atom等文本编辑器。这些编辑器具有丰富的插件和代码高亮功能,可以方便地编辑HTML、CSS和JavaScript等Web语言。
总之,选择适合自己的编程软件是很重要的。你可以根据个人喜好和学习需求,选择一款适合自己的编程软件,开始编程的学习之旅。
1年前 -
-
学编程入门最常用的软件有以下几种:
-
编辑器(Editor):编程过程中需要使用文本编辑器来编写代码。最简单的文本编辑器可以是操作系统自带的记事本(Windows)或文本编辑器(Mac),但更常用的是专门为编程设计的编辑器,例如Visual Studio Code、Sublime Text、Atom等。这些编辑器具有语法高亮、自动补全、代码片段等功能,可以提高编程效率。
-
集成开发环境(Integrated Development Environment,IDE):IDE是一种集成了编辑器、编译器、调试器等工具的软件,能够提供更全面的开发环境。常用的IDE有Visual Studio、Eclipse、IntelliJ IDEA等。IDE通常具有代码自动补全、调试功能、版本控制等特性,适合用于大型项目的开发。
-
解释器(Interpreter):某些编程语言需要通过解释器来执行代码。解释器可以直接运行源代码,无需事先编译。常见的解释器包括Python解释器、Ruby解释器等。学习这些编程语言时,需要下载并安装相应的解释器。
-
虚拟机(Virtual Machine):有些编程语言需要在虚拟机上运行,虚拟机模拟了一个计算机环境,可以在其中执行特定的代码。常见的虚拟机有Java虚拟机(JVM)和.NET虚拟机(CLR)。学习这些编程语言时,需要下载并安装相应的虚拟机。
-
特定领域工具(Domain-specific Tools):在学习特定领域的编程时,可能需要使用特定的工具。例如,学习游戏开发时可能会使用Unity或Unreal Engine;学习Web开发时可能会使用Web开发框架和服务器软件等。这些工具通常具有特定的功能和特性,能够提供更便捷的开发环境。
选择合适的软件取决于你学习的编程语言和开发领域。对于初学者来说,通常推荐使用简单易用的编辑器或IDE,以便更专注于学习编程的基础知识。随着学习的深入,可以根据自己的需求选择更适合的工具。
1年前 -
-
学习编程入门可以使用多种软件,以下是一些常用的选择:
-
编辑器(Editor):编写代码的工具,可以提供代码高亮、自动补全等功能。常见的编辑器有:
- Visual Studio Code:免费、跨平台的编辑器,支持多种编程语言。
- Sublime Text:功能强大、快速的编辑器,支持多种插件。
- Atom:开源、可定制的编辑器,支持多种编程语言。
-
集成开发环境(Integrated Development Environment,IDE):提供了更全面的开发功能,包括代码编辑、调试、编译等。常见的IDE有:
- PyCharm:针对Python开发的IDE,提供了丰富的功能和插件。
- Eclipse:开源的Java IDE,支持多种编程语言。
- IntelliJ IDEA:适用于Java、Kotlin等语言的IDE,提供了智能代码提示和重构功能。
-
Jupyter Notebook:用于数据科学和机器学习的交互式开发环境。可以在浏览器中编写和运行代码,并且可以直接展示代码的运行结果和图表。
-
在线编程平台:提供了在线编辑和运行代码的环境,无需安装任何软件。常见的在线编程平台有:
- Repl.it:支持多种编程语言,提供了即时运行代码的功能。
- CodePen:主要用于前端开发,可以实时预览代码的效果。
- Google Colab:基于Jupyter Notebook的云端编程环境,可以免费使用GPU和TPU资源。
选择哪种软件取决于你学习的编程语言和个人的偏好。初学者可以从使用免费、易于上手的编辑器开始,随着对编程的熟悉度提升,再考虑使用更专业的IDE。在线编程平台则适合快速尝试和分享代码。
1年前 -